Latest Patents

One of Carlson's latest patents is titled "Apparatus and method for in-line insertion and removal of markers." This invention provides an apparatus for performing a DMA operation between a host memory in a first server and a network adapter. The apparatus includes a host frame parser and a protocol engine. The host frame parser is designed to receive data corresponding to the DMA operation from a host interface. It is capable of inserting markers on-the-fly into the data at a prescribed interval and providing marked data for transmission to a second server over a network fabric. The protocol engine, which is coupled to the host frame parser, directs the host frame parser to insert the markers and specifies a first marker value and an offset value. This enables the host frame parser to locate and insert a first marker into the data.
